Output 33668c04b463590ec00a4f7ff3bece25a56fe8564defe82f68769db68d85231e:7

value
1340077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6fc08d30da922ca8d9c752576770b4b21a4f7d6 OP_EQUAL
address
3QCx5PvYAS6MdEjVf3jfe675MbfH1xW1pV
transaction
33668c04b463590ec00a4f7ff3bece25a56fe8564defe82f68769db68d85231e
confirmations
304731
spent
true